Brampton Primary School Catchment Area Information

What is the catchment area for Brampton Primary School?

The catchment area for Brampton Primary School is the geographic zone Derbyshire uses to prioritise admissions when this primary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and siblings. Derbyshire publ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

Brampton Primary School: 343 places, 88% filled: places available

Brampton Primary School has a published admission number of 343 places. 303 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 88%. At 88% full, the school currently has headroom below its 343 place limit. Catchment distance criteria still apply when the school is oversubscribed, but at current demand levels, places have been available for applicants outside the immediate catchment area.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 40.5% of pupils at Brampton Primary School are eligible for free school meals, above the national average of around 24%. This reflects the school's role in a higher-deprivation area of Chesterfield.
